PARP Inhibitors in Clinical Use Induce Genomic Instability in Normal Human Cells
18 Jul 2016
Abstract excerpt
Poly(ADP-ribose) polymerases (PARPs) are the first proteins involved in cellular DNA repair pathways to be targeted by specific inhibitors for clinical benefit. Tumors harboring genetic defects in homologous recombination (HR), a DNA double-strand break (DSB) repair pathway, are hypersensitive to PARP inhibitors (PARPi).
